1/// Test determinisim when serializing anonymous decls. Create enough Decls in
2/// DeclContext that can overflow the small storage of SmallPtrSet to make sure
3/// the serialization does not rely on iteration order of SmallPtrSet.
4// RUN: rm -rf %t.dir
5// RUN: split-file %s %t.dir
6// RUN: %clang_cc1 -fmodules -fimplicit-module-maps \
7// RUN:   -fmodules-cache-path=%t.dir/cache -triple x86_64-apple-macosx10.11.0 \
8// RUN:   -I%t.dir/headers %t.dir/main.m -fdisable-module-hash -Wno-visibility
9// RUN: mv %t.dir/cache/A.pcm %t1.pcm
10/// Check the order of the decls first. If LLVM_ENABLE_REVERSE_ITERATION is on,
11/// it will fail the test early if the output is depending on the order of items
12/// in containers that has non-deterministic orders.
13// RUN: llvm-bcanalyzer --dump --disable-histogram %t1.pcm | FileCheck %s
14// RUN: rm -rf %t.dir/cache
15// RUN: %clang_cc1 -fmodules -fimplicit-module-maps \
16// RUN:   -fmodules-cache-path=%t.dir/cache -triple x86_64-apple-macosx10.11.0 \
17// RUN:   -I%t.dir/headers %t.dir/main.m -fdisable-module-hash -Wno-visibility
18// RUN: mv %t.dir/cache/A.pcm %t2.pcm
19// RUN: diff %t1.pcm %t2.pcm
